Editorial overview Touché

Equator: A Journey by Thurston Clarke is a firsthand account published by William Morrow & Co in 1988. This first edition spans 463 pages and is presented in English. The book chronicles the author’s three-year trek along the equator, detailing his encounters with a variety of people and cultures, showcasing both exotic and familiar ways of life.

Readers will find a vivid exploration of the diverse landscapes and communities along the equatorial line. Clarke’s narrative offers insights into the rich tapestry of human experience, emphasizing the unique customs and traditions he observed during his travels. This account of voyages and travels invites readers to engage with the complexities of life in different regions, making it a significant contribution to the genre.
